ARM are currently recruiting for an exciting opportunity for a Mechanical Engineer to work on a contract basis with a leading client in the Nuclear industry.
What you'll be doing
- Promote effective co-operation across Engineering and other functional teams
- Assist in effective management of the customer, through interfacing with customers and supply chain on design issues and assist with procurement specifications
- Ensure procedures, codes and standards are correctly identified and applied to engineering and technical activities.
- Contribute to Product Safety Assessment process
- Provide a technical interface with internal and external stakeholders at a detailed level
- Carry out technical investigations and analysis to provide data for problem assessment/resolution and for design of improvements
- Contribute to process improvement within the operational and/or design lifecycle to deliver continuous improvements in quality, cycle time and asset utilisation
- Apply engineering domain knowledge to produce technical solutions and documentation in support of assigned task and project
- Produce, review, verify outputs including: calculations, analyses, technical reports, technical specifications and method statements
- Ensure appropriate review, verification and approval is undertaken on work performed
- Make engineering decisions within own sphere of responsibility and delegated authority
- Support business development opportunities in raising the Cavendish Nuclear profile via presentations, academic links, conferences & technical papers, and identify opportunities and new work streams
What do you need to succeed?
- Engineering degree (or equivalent qualification) in relevant engineering discipline, with significant demonstrable experience
- Candidates MUST hold live SC clearance
- Experience working in the Nuclear or Defence sector
Details of the contract
- 6 month contract
- £45- £55 per hour inside IR35 plus £5 per hour shift allowance and £50 per day for accommodation
